DescriptionA Western Air Express Tri-motor Fokker F-10 aircraft with the registration number NC 279E is being refueled near hangar #1 at Albuquerque Airport in Albuquerque, New Mexico. A man stands near the wing to refuel the plane. A large crowd is standing around the airplane. Handwriting on the back reads, "First tri-motor Fokker to land at Alb. Airport. It was later put in service by Western Air Inc. from Coast to Coast with regular stops at Albuquerque, N.M."On View
